The Net Shall Shall Stay Free- Network Neutrality Rule Adopted

From WSJ:

The Federal Communications Commission on Thursday approved a much-anticipated open Internet proposal despite concerns of commission Republicans and big cable and phone companies that the rules aren’t necessary.

Supporters of the proposal, including Internet giants like Google Inc., say the rules are needed to ensure entrepreneurs’ Web products aren’t hampered by providers that supply the on-ramps to the Internet.

The proposed FCC rules would prevent Internet companies such as Verizon Communications Inc., Comcast Corp. and AT&T Inc. from selectively blocking or slowing certain Web content and would require providers to disclose how they manage their networks.

The FCC now will seek public comment, with the goal of finalizing the proposal sometime next year. The rules almost certainly will be challenged in court.

AT&T, Verizon, and Comcast worry that the new rules apply only to service providers like them and not Internet firms like Google and Amazon.com Inc.

Advocates like Google say broader rules would amount to unprecedented regulation of the now free Internet.

The rules are tailored toward ISPs. They say Internet access providers can’t deprive users of competition “among network providers, application providers, service providers, and content providers.”

FCC Chairman Julius Genachowski said the draft rules are designed to protect consumers’ right to access lawful content, applications, and services. “Government should not be in the business of running or regulating the Internet,” he said.

Obama Nobel Peace Prize Unconstitutional

From WaPo, of all places:

People can, and undoubtedly will, argue for some time about whether President Obama deserves the Nobel Peace Prize. Meanwhile, though, there’s a simpler and more immediate question: Does the Constitution allow him to accept the award?

Article I, Section 9, of the Constitution, the Emolument Clause, clearly stipulates: “And no Person holding any Office of Profit or Trust under them, shall, without the Consent of the Congress, accept of any present, Emolument, Office, or Title, of any kind whatever, from any King, Prince or foreign State.”

The award of the peace prize to a sitting President is not unprecedented. But Theodore Roosevelt and Woodrow Wilson received the honor for their past actions: Roosevelt’s efforts to end the Russo-Japanese War and Wilson’s work in establishing establish the League of Nations. Obama’s award is different. It is intended to affect future action. As a member of the Nobel Committee explained, the Prize should encourage Obama to meet his goal of nuclear disarmament. It raises important legal questions for the second time in less than 10 months — questions not discussed, much less adequately addressed anywhere else.

The five-member Nobel commission is elected by the Storting, the Parliament of Norway. Thus the award of the peace prize is made by a body representing the legislature of a sovereign foreign state. There is no doubt that the Nobel Peace Prize is an “emolument” (”gain from employment or position,” according to Webster).

An opinion of the U.S. Attorney General advised, in 1902 that “a simple remembrance,” even “if merely a photograph, falls under the inclusion of ‘any present of any kind whatever.’ ” President Clinton’s Office of Legal Counsel, in 1993, reaffirmed the 1902 opinion, and explained that the text of the clause does not limit “its application solely to foreign governments acting as sovereigns.” This opinion went on to say that the Emolument Clause applies even when the foreign government acts through instrumentalities. Thus the Nobel Prize is an emolument, and a foreign one to boot.

The Dollar’s Collapse? Is This Being Done On Purpose?

From Breitbart:

The dollar’s position as the world’s leading reserve currency faces increased pressure as the financial crisis allows emerging economies greater influence on the world stage, analysts said.

A report last week in The Independent claiming that China, Russia and Gulf States are among nations prepared to ditch the dollar for oil trades has heightened the uncertainty surrounding the US currency’s future. The dollar slumped against rivals last week in the wake of the British daily’s controversial report.

“The US dollar is being hurt by the continued talk of a shift away from a dollar-centric world,” said Kit Juckes, an analyst at currency traders ECU Group.

“Three conclusions stand out very clearly. Firstly, the shift in economic power away from the G7 economies is continuing. “Secondly, there is a growing acceptance amongst those winners that one consequence of this power shift will be to strengthen their currencies.”

And finally, as long as the US economy is not strong enough for any rise in interest rates to be conceivable for a long time, the dollar’s underlying downtrend will remain in place,” added Juckes.
